It is a hawk-eagle isn't it Koel? The bill's too large for OHB and the eyes and head shape are wrong too. OHB doesn't have the bony "hoods" over the eyes that eagles, such as this, have.

Nope, if you'll pardon my leaping in. Koel is right and I too was initially fooled. It's an OH-b and here's why (any other available photos might help clarify):
1) the legs are only part-feathered, typical of H-b, tho' most fieldguides don't mention it; Spizaetus are fully feathered down to the toes (and even lower in some) ; 2) the head and bill are smallish and weak and there is no fierce brow-ridge - the bird has its head tilted which exaggerates the shadow some, but it still has a "benign" expression;  3) the lower tarsus is pretty hefty but the toes are spindly; I've noticed H-b seem to have folds of baggy skin around the lower tarsus, perhaps as further defense against stings; 4) the lore/cheek area appears to have the scaly feathering of H-b; 5) tho' not exactly clear, the typical H-b slit nostril seems to be present (eagles rounded to oval); 6) the crest is straggly and spindly (thin feathers) and horizontally drooped; in Spizaetus it is usually held vertically when in this pose and feathers are broader.  There are other minor supporting features.
